Xcel Energy, McGough Construction fined for St. Paul stormwater discharges

Xcel Energy and McGough Construction were both fined by the Minnesota Pollution Control Agency (MPCA) for not informing state officials about multiple stormwater discharges in St. Paul and failing to conduct stormwater management inspections for most of 2025.

Minnesota Lynx head coach Cheryl Reeve now holds the WNBA record for most regular season wins. The Lynx beat the Connecticut Sun 86-80 on July 8, netting Reeve her 380th regular season victory.
